Locksmith Car Near Me: Finding the Right Professional in Your Time of Need

When you're locked out of your car, it can be a demanding and aggravating experience. Whether you've lost your keys, locked them inside the vehicle, or your key fob has actually stopped working, the need for a reputable and professional locksmith near you ends up being instant. In such minutes, knowing how to find a reliable locksmith and comprehending the services they use can significantly alleviate the situation.

The Importance of a Professional Locksmith

A professional locksmith is more than simply somebody who can get you back into your car. They are trained to manage a variety of lock-related concerns, from rekeying locks to changing lost keys. Here are some key reasons that you should go with an expert locksmith:

  1. Experience and Expertise: Professional locksmiths have substantial training and experience, which indicates they can handle complicated lock mechanisms and emergencies efficiently.
  2. Tools and Equipment: They bring a wide variety of specialized tools and equipment, ensuring they can deal with any issue rapidly and effectively.
  3. Security and Privacy: Professional locksmith professionals are bonded and guaranteed, providing a layer of security and personal privacy for you and your vehicle.
  4. 24/7 Availability: Many locksmith services provide ongoing support, ensuring you can get assist whenever you need it.

Common Services Offered by Car Locksmiths

Car locksmith professionals supply a variety of services to help you restore access to your vehicle and guarantee its security. Here are a few of the most typical services:

  1. Car Lockout Assistance: If you're locked out of your car locksmiths, a locksmith can open the door without triggering damage.
  2. Key Replacement: They can create brand-new keys if you've lost your original set.
  3. Key Fob Programming: Modern cars typically utilize key fobs, and a professional locksmith can program a new fob or reset an existing one.
  4. Ignition Repair: If your ignition switch is malfunctioning, a locksmith can diagnose and repair the concern.
  5. Transponder Key Services: Many cars and trucks utilize transponder keys, which need specialized programming. An expert locksmith can manage this for you.
  6. Lock Rekeying: If you require to alter the locks on your car, a locksmith can rekey them to match a brand-new set of keys.
  7. Safe and Secure Entry: They can offer safe and secure entry techniques, such as utilizing lock picks or slim jims, to prevent any damage to your vehicle.

What to Expect When You Call a Locksmith

  1. Initial Contact: When you call a locksmith, supply them with your location and a brief description of the issue.
  2. Arrival Time: Ask about their estimated arrival time. The majority of reputable locksmiths can arrive within 30 minutes to an hour.
  3. Confirmation: Upon arrival, the locksmith will confirm your identity and ownership of the vehicle to guarantee they are supplying service to the best person.
  4. Diagnosis and Solution: They will examine the situation and provide an option, describing any charges and the process involved.
  5. Payment: Once the service is finished, they will offer an itemized costs and accept numerous payment methods, including cash, credit cards, and mobile car key locksmith payments.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)

Q: How much does a car locksmith service expense?A: The expense of a car locksmith service can vary depending upon the kind of service, the intricacy of the lock, and the area. Generally, you can expect to pay in between ₤ 50 and ₤ 150 for a basic car lockout service. Key replacement and programming can range from ₤ 75 to ₤ 200.

Q: Can a locksmith open a car without a key?A: Yes, a professional locksmith can use different tools and strategies, such as lock choices or slim jims, to open a car without a key. They are trained to do this efficiently and without causing damage to the vehicle.

Q: Is it legal for a locksmith to open my car?A: Yes, it is legal for a locksmith to open your car, supplied they verify your identity and ownership of the vehicle. This is a standard practice to make sure the security and integrity of the service.

Q: How long does it take for a locksmith to open a car?A: The time it takes for a locksmith to open a car can differ, however it usually takes between 5 and 30 minutes. Elements like the kind of lock and the locksmith's experience can impact the period.

Q: Can a locksmith make a new key for my car?A: Yes, an expert locksmith can develop a brand-new key for your car key and locksmith. They can also program transponder keys for contemporary vehicles.

Q: Do I need to be present when the locksmith shows up?A: Yes, it is essential to be present when the locksmith shows up. They require to validate your identity and ownership of the vehicle before providing service.

Q: Can a locksmith replace a broken ignition switch?A: Yes, many locksmiths use ignition switch repair and replacement services. They can detect the problem and replace the switch if necessary.
